Course Maintenance - Green Keeping Talent Pool focuses on assisting in the planning and execution of course maintenance programs, seasonal renovations, and improvements.

What the role involves

  • Assisting in the planning and execution of course maintenance programs, seasonal renovations, and improvements.
  • Monitoring the health of turf and plants, applying fertilizers and pesticides as necessary in compliance with safety guidelines.
  • Repair course equipment and machinery to ensure optimal functionality.
  • Work as part of a team to manage the daily operations of the course, including assisting with maintenance of bunkers, greens, and tee boxes.
  • Reporting findings to the Course Manager.
  • Conduct regular inspections of the course to identify areas needing attention.

Skills and requirements

  • No prior experience as a green keeper is necessary as full training will be provided however, a passion for horticulture, landscaping, or golf is a plus.
  • Opportunities for Full Time apprenticeships and continued CPD training will be provided as part of this role with a reputable college and BIGGA approved courses.
  • A keen interest in the principles of turf management and environmental sustainability.
  • Develop skills in course maintenance and landscaping techniques.
